About Us

Kyriba is a global leader in liquidity performance that empowers CFOs, Treasurers and IT leaders to connect, protect, forecast and optimize their liquidity. As a secure and scalable SaaS solution, Kyriba brings intelligence and financial automation that enables companies and banks of all sizes to improve their financial performance and increase operational efficiency. Kyriba’s real-time data and AI-empowered tools empower its 3,000 customers worldwide to quantify exposures, project cash and liquidity, and take action to protect balance sheets, income statements and cash flows. Kyriba manages more than 3.5 billion bank transactions and $15 trillion in payments annually and gives customers complete visibility and actionability, so they can optimize and fully harness liquidity across the enterprise and outperform their business strategy. About the role

The driving force behind our continuous success has always been our people and we are looking for a Sales Enablement leader who can help us elevate a best-in-class Sales Enablement team to meet the evolving needs of our growing organization. We require a leader with sales and go-to-market leadership experience who can transform the sales enablement program to increase the efficiency and effectiveness of our sales and partner teams through elevated messaging, knowledge transfer and on-demand resources.

The successful candidate will be responsible for enabling and equipping the Kyriba global sales teams and partners with the tools and knowledge to acquire, retain and grow revenue while establishing cohesion across all disciplines and functions to achieve our strategic goals.

The role will provide strategic thought leadership across the organization to drive revenue growth and will continuously introduce and enhance sales enablement initiatives.

Key responsibilities
  • Execute a vision for sales enablement with a clear plan for the resources, tools and deliverables required to elevate sales performance and efficiency to the next level

  • Partner with sales and go-to-market leaders to align on enablement priorities to drive our growth revenue strategy including client upsell and cross-sell programs.

  • Develop a team of Kyriba subject matter experts across industry issues, product capabilities and sales processes.

  • Deliver competitive insights program to analyze Kyriba’s competitive landscape with a feedback loop to Kyriba leaders

  • Collaborate with sales and partner leaders on a sales methodology to increase sales effectiveness while identifying and remedying opportunities for sales improvement

  • Support new product launches by preparing and enabling sales teams to more effectively sell new products and influential features

  • Maintain a sales enablement resource center in Highspot so that sales teams have the playbooks, presentations and content they need to efficiently manage end-to-end sales cycles

  • Regularly spend time with the local teams and reps to understand the ''field reality'' and optimize sales enablement deliverables to meet emerging needs

Qualifications
  • Sales, sales enablement, product marketing and go-to-market experience in a B2B software environment

  • Leadership experience managing high producing go-to-market teams

  • Expertise in corporate finance with a preferred focus on treasury, payments and risk management practices including CFO and Treasurer personas

  • Strong presentation skills with a track record of highly rated business presentations

  • Superior slide presentation, spreadsheet and writing skills
